## What's new
**📧 Outlook & Microsoft 365 support.** Connect a Microsoft account and get the full Rowboat email experience — inbox with AI triage, thread view, compose and reply, drafts, whole-mailbox search, attachments, and calendar-fed meetings — exactly as it works with Gmail. Sign-in happens right in the app; no extra setup needed.
**✅ Home is now your to-do list.** Home becomes a rolling to-do list shared between you and @rowboat: mention @rowboat on an item to delegate it, steer the work with inline comments, and get one-line receipts back on the list. Recent conversations live on the same surface, with one composer at the bottom serving both. An opt-in morning planner can suggest up to three high-signal items a day — nothing runs without your explicit accept. The old Home is one click away as Overview.
**📽️ Edit PowerPoint decks without leaving Rowboat.** Open a `.pptx` from your workspace and it renders with real theme colors, fills, images, and bullets. Double-click to edit text, move and resize shapes, add, duplicate, reorder, and delete slides, change fonts and formatting, then hit Play for a full-screen presentation. Saves touch only what you edited — charts, SmartArt, and animations pass through untouched, and files don't bloat across saves.
**🖱️ The assistant can point at your screen.** During a screen share, the assistant can drop an animated pointer on the thing it's talking about — right on your real screen. The voice companion is now one coherent surface: the mascot with a foldable text panel, a live status line showing what the agent is doing ("Searching the web…", "Reasoning…"), and speech that matches how you asked — spoken questions get spoken replies, typed ones stay silent.
**🧠 See the model think, and pick how hard it thinks.** The chat now renders the model's reasoning as it streams, and every model picker carries a reasoning-effort setting (low / medium / high) that follows your choice all the way through — including mid-chat model switches, which no longer error.
**🪟 Quick-ask bar on Windows.** The ⌥⇧Space quick-ask bar from v0.8.3 now works on Windows too, and got a proper light-mode redesign on all platforms.
### Also in this release
- New Settings → Permissions panel: every OS permission grouped by the feature it serves, with honest statuses and one-click grant buttons or System Settings deep links
- Old chats and task transcripts are now cleaned up automatically (storage retention), and deleting a chat removes all of its files — including sub-agent transcripts
- Email replies quote the conversation trail like a normal mail client, you no longer get notified about your own sent mail, and the Important section gained date dividers
- The side-pane chat now renders identically to the full-screen chat, with quiet one-line tool rows keeping transcripts readable
- Background tasks gained a row menu with a details popup and delete confirmation
- Connecting accounts is more reliable — an OAuth bug that could silently swallow the sign-in callback is fixed
- Remote MCP servers now receive your configured headers — thanks to first-time contributor [@serhiizghama](https://github.com/serhiizghama) for the fix!
- The in-app update card shows release notes in full instead of truncating them
